Presumably a month's worth of points is a very large number. The query takes a long time because it's potentially scanning millions of points across at least 4 and possibly more shards.
Use a continuous query to pre-calculate your MIN() and MAX() values on an hourly or daily basis and store those values in a new measurement. Then issue the SPREAD() call to that downsampled data rather than the raw data.
